小电流接地系统单相接地故障选线方法的研究

摘    要:针对小电流接地系统中的故障选线问题,指出了利用暂态量进行故障选线的研究方法。利用小波包的良好的频域分频特性,通过比较各线路暂态零序电流在所确定的频段下的小波包重构的高频分量的极性来实现故障选线。针对电压过零值附近时,该方法容易误判,应用小波奇异性检测功能,获取故障引起的电压、电流突变量的极性和大小来选线。两种方法扬长避短,从而达到最佳选线目的。通过MATLAB仿真结果表明此方法可以准确地实现单相故障选线,为实际工程应用提供了理论指导。

关 键 词:小电流接地系统  单相接地  小波分析  故障选线
